I'm posting this to warn others about my experience with BC.Game. I have wagered a total over $7.5 million on their sportsbook and reached Diamond SVIP status. Despite that, my account has effectively been restricted for over 1.5 years, with my maximum bet limit reduced to almost $0. Because of this I was unable to continue betting at all. My activity dropped because they restricted match betting on my account, I eventually lost my VIP host and all VIP benefits. After 18 months my account limits were reset to the same level as a newly registered user I have contacted their customer support (quite a lot of times). My VIP host and the so-called "CEO Inbox" feature which was supposedly created for unresolved cases like this and I have been ignored there for over a month and now they've removed the entire CEO Inbox button from their website. Nothing has changed. No explanation, no resolution and what makes this worse is that this situation has been ongoing for over a year, and no one at BC.Game seems willing (or able) to fix it. At this point, I can only conclude that high-volume players are not treated fairly and VIP status means nothing when issues arise. Support is also completely ineffective with only Indians working there lol. I'm sharing this so others are aware before depositing or committing serious volume to this platform. Creating activity on a gambling site will gradually increase your limits on sports betting. Wagering millions will ensure your account can have a x10 or higher limit on sports betting compared to a freshly registered account. I am aware that others had posted their story about Thunderpick last year and that there is most likely no solution to having this problem fixed. I am still posting this to warn others about the site and advise them to stay away from this website. I created my account on Thunderpick on October 14th. Basically because there was a CS2 event happening (CS Asia Championships 2025) and literally no other bookmakers were providing live odds at day 1 of the event. Thunderpick was basically the only website that managed to have live odds on the first day of that event. I deposited $500 to play around and ended up winning 19 bets in a row. After this win-streak, they decided to suspend my account and ask for additional information regarding my identity. Their email contained the message: "We are contacting you from Thunderpick Customer Service. In order to complete your account’s verification process, we'll need to verify your identity and address". They asked for full address verification, my ID and me holding my ID next to my face. After having provided them with the information, they got back to me after 6 days and told me that they weren't able to verify my account with the documents I provided and asked me to hold a piece of paper with their website and the date on it. After having sent this information they never got back to me again, I keep bumping up the case every few days but I keep getting the same response "Unfortunately, your account is still under review and you will be updated via email once review has been completed." which is strange as they stated they require 1-2 business days to review the documents in their first email. After doing some research, I found multiple threads and complaints from other users describing the exact same pattern: once you win a large amount, Thunderpick freezes your account, demands excessive KYC, and then ghosts you.
